About Oughtibridge

Oughtibridge is a village located in South Yorkshire, England, within the S35 postcode area. It lies approximately six miles north of Sheffield, making it a convenient location for those wishing to access the city while enjoying a quieter village atmosphere. The village is surrounded by picturesque countryside, offering opportunities for walking and outdoor activities.

The centre of Oughtibridge features a selection of local shops, cafés, and amenities that cater to residents and visitors alike. The area is served by public transport, providing easy connections to nearby towns and cities. Oughtibridge also has a primary school, making it a suitable place for families. The village's community spirit is evident through various local events and activities that take place throughout the year.

Household Income in Oughtibridge ONS 2023

The average total household income in Oughtibridge is approximately £50,438 a year before tax, 9% below the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£37,250.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Oughtibridge ONS 2025

There are approximately 1,227 active businesses based in Oughtibridge, around 30 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 88%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 27 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Oughtibridge

Of the 17,920 households in and around Oughtibridge, 77% are owned, 13% are socially rented and 10%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
